When you look at dental bills, the final amount depends on several variables. The biggest factors are the complexity of the procedure and the materials used, such as whether a crown is porcelain or gold. If you have insurance, that impacts your out-of-pocket share, while those paying cash might see different rates based on the office's overhead. A dentist is a healthcare professional who specializes in the diagnosis, prevention, and treatment of diseases and conditions of the oral cavity. They perform routine cleanings, fill cavities, extract teeth, and can also address more complex issues. In Milwaukee, these professionals are focused on maintaining your overall oral health.

Wisdom teeth are often the most challenging to remove due to their location at the very back of the mouth and their potential to be impacted or have complex root structures.
